GXO Logistics Inc is a contract logistics company. Its revenue is diversified across numerous verticals and customers, including many multinational corporations. It provides warehousing and distribution, order fulfillment, e-commerce, reverse logistics, and other supply chain services differentiated by its ability to deliver technology-enabled, customized solutions at scale. Geographically, it generates revenue from the United Kingdom, the United States, the Netherlands, France, Spain, Italy, and other countries, and derives the majority of its revenue from the United Kingdom.
Fortune Brands is a US-based homebuilding products company that sells building-related products serving R&R and new construction markets. The company operates in three segments: water, outdoors, and security. Water innovation, including plumbing fixtures and faucets, accounts for around 55% of total sales and features brands such as Moen, House of Rohl, and Aqualisa. The outdoors segment includes decking, railing, and doors and makes up 30% of total sales, featuring brands such as Larson, Fiberon, and Therma-Tru. The security segment, which includes smart residential padlocks, accounts for the remaining 15% of sales and features brands such as MasterLock, SentrySafe, Yale, and AmericanLock.
